A nonprofit gallery is an art space that operates without the intention of making a profit, focusing instead on promoting and exhibiting art for the benefit of the community and artists. These galleries often rely on funding from grants, donations, and memberships to support their operations and programming, which can include exhibitions, educational initiatives, and outreach activities. Nonprofit galleries play a crucial role in fostering artistic expression and providing opportunities for underrepresented artists.
